Merge tag 'omapdrm-4.10-fixes' of git://git.kernel.org/pub/scm/linux/kernel/git/tomba/linux into drm-next

omapdrm fixes for v4.10

* fix tpd12s015's error handling, which causes omap5 uevm HDMI to fail
* fix omapdrm primary plane allocation bug, which makes the display to fail to
  come up

* tag 'omapdrm-4.10-fixes' of git://git.kernel.org/pub/scm/linux/kernel/git/tomba/linux:
  drm/omap: tpd12s015: fix error handling
  drm/omap: fix primary-plane's possible_crtcs
  drm: fix possible_crtc's type
